Transaction 8455fea914adf6119688887dc6b7be0223208c2031e4f5803ff91fd74d36c68e
1 Input
1 Output
-
8455fea914adf6119688887dc6b7be0223208c2031e4f5803ff91fd74d36c68e:0
- value
- 2184710
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5f68bd5d8300304a9125ffe1aa121b749e7f16f
- address
- bc1quhmgh4wcxqpsf2gjtllp4gfpkay70ut0hg0nfs